PETERSFIELD TOWN slipped to a 1-0 defeat against a strong Andover Town team in the sweltering heat at Love Lane on Saturday in Division 1 of the Wessex League.

Rams keeper Jordi Wilson did well early on, coming out to deny Andover’s Ryan Griffiths.

Lewis Williams grabbed the only goal of the game in the 27th minute. A diagonal ball into the box caused problems, and Williams hit his shot into the bottom corner after an excellent touch.

Six minutes later Williams went past Kieran Alcock and shot low towards the corner, but his effort was parried away by Wilson.

Petersfield created their first chance five minutes before half-time when Connor Hoare’s crossfield ball into the box found Josh Rose, but his effort came off his shoulder and provided no threat.

Andover almost doubled their advantage in the second half when Brandon Holmes’ long throw found Ben Evans, who hit his shot against the outside of the post.

The Rams created a few chances as they pushed for an equaliser.

Christian Bennett’s shot almost squirmed under the Andover keeper, but he eventually held it.

In stoppage time Mino Djaura’s shot was well blocked.
